Emergency landings on highways, while rare, do occur. Pilots may resort to this option when facing critical situations like engine failure or fuel exhaustion. The FAA records such incidents, but they are infrequent compared to overall flights. Highway landings can be dangerous due to traffic, but they provide a viable alternative when airports are not accessible.

Pilots handle in-flight emergencies by following established protocols, which include assessing the situation, communicating with air traffic control, and preparing for a safe landing. Training emphasizes calm decision-making under pressure, allowing pilots to prioritize actions like troubleshooting the issue and finding suitable landing locations, whether on runways or highways.
Legal implications of plane crashes can involve investigations by aviation authorities, potential liability claims, and regulatory scrutiny. If negligence is determined, parties such as the pilot, aircraft manufacturers, or maintenance providers may face lawsuits. Additionally, the FAA may impose penalties for violations of safety regulations, emphasizing accountability in aviation.

The FAA responds to aviation incidents by conducting thorough investigations to determine causes and recommend safety improvements. They analyze data from accidents to identify trends, enforce regulations, and implement new safety measures. The FAA also collaborates with local authorities to ensure that emergency response protocols are effective and that lessons learned are shared across the aviation community.
Pilots utilize various technologies during emergencies, including GPS for navigation, autopilot systems to stabilize the aircraft, and communication tools to contact air traffic control. Advanced avionics provide real-time data on aircraft performance, while emergency checklists help pilots systematically address issues. These technologies enhance situational awareness and decision-making capabilities.

Eyewitness accounts play a crucial role in aviation investigations, providing immediate, on-the-ground perspectives that can clarify the sequence of events. These testimonies can help investigators understand the circumstances leading to an emergency, assess pilot actions, and evaluate the effectiveness of safety measures. Eyewitnesses can also offer insights into the impact on individuals involved, contributing to a comprehensive analysis.
